The heart of the novel is Daunis’s struggle with belonging. Born to a white mother from a wealthy Fontaine family and a deceased Ojibwe father from the Firekeeper clan, she is "too white" for some and "not native enough" for others as an unenrolled tribal member. Angeline Boulley, an enrolled member of the Sault Ste. Marie Tribe of Chippewa Indians, spent over a decade crafting this novel. She consulted with tribal elders, language keepers, and recovering addicts to ensure accuracy. The book respectfully incorporates Ojibwemowin (the Ojibwe language) and traditions such as the Firekeeper’s role—a ceremonial duty to tend the sacred fire.

Published in 2021, Angeline Boulley’s debut novel, Firekeeper’s Daughter , became an instant #1 New York Times bestseller and won the Edgar Award for Best Young Adult Mystery. Part thriller, part coming-of-age story, the book follows Daunis Fontaine, an 18-year-old biracial Ojibwe woman who goes undercover in a drug investigation that threatens her community.
